Output 85fc283befd8579b4bc89a4de5181bfda4cc4a020a5224e472bf81c3836cfb4d:0

value
15131089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 438d6b348af5c9575423b17103854b9a05ef84c3 OP_EQUAL
address
37rCcLxFM77rRVDC4WZDQ4QcZCQxYyL8Cc
transaction
85fc283befd8579b4bc89a4de5181bfda4cc4a020a5224e472bf81c3836cfb4d
confirmations
389266
spent
true